WebA CSS is caused by any pathology or lesion present within the cavernous sinus that disrupts the function of other anatomical structures. The most common cause of CSS is mass effect from tumor. Other common causes of CSS include trauma and self-limited inflammatory disease. Less common causes are vascular etiologies and infections. WebSurgery: One common cause of primary hypopituitarism is complications from the surgery that was used to remove a pituitary adenoma or certain kinds of brain surgery. Radiation therapy: Prior cancer radiation therapy or radiation used to treat a pituitary adenoma can cause damage to your pituitary gland or hypothalamus. WebMar 17, 2008 · Pituitary apoplexy is characterized by sudden onset of headache, visual symptoms, altered mental status, and hormonal dysfunction. It may be hemorrhagic or nonhemorrhagic.
